    I had same issue. When your gpu goes into the "02:00.0 VGA compatible controller: Advanced Micro Devices, Inc. [AMD/ATI] Device 67ef (rev ff) (prog-if ff)" state, it indicated that the device isn't coming back from a bus reset properly. I would update your kernel on host to the latest version, but in my case it was a hardware issue.

    It happens when your VM shuts down, the bus resets the card, the card/bus doesn't come back properly from the bus reset. There is code in those threads I linked below that will allow you to test it outside of a VM.
